Funeral Services Conducted For Mrs. Laura Hicks January 24Funeral services were held in Anson Saturday January 24, for Mrs.. Laura Hicks, who had lived her for fifty years. She died of a heart attack at 2:35 oclock Friday aiternoon, January 23.Mrs. Hicks was born in Alabama on December 15, 1854. She was Laura Creel before her marriage to Ed Hicks. Mr. Hicks died twelve years ago.Funeral services were heldat the Primitive Baptist Church at 2:30 oclock last Saturday afternoon. All funeral arrangements were in charge of Lawrence Funeral Ho;r e.Mrs. Kicks had no children and there are no immediate survivors. She was living in the home of her niece, Mrs. George Pearce, at the time of her death. Nieces and nephews, besides Mrs. Pearce, are Mrs. Joe Crawford and Mrs. Bo Reed of Anson, Mrs. Bill Mimms of San Angelo, Jodie Creel of San Angelo, Bill and Eddie Creel of Anson, and Ted Creel of Pasadena, California.Pallbearers were: TomHolland of Rochester; W. B.t Georgia, and Marvin Mayfield; George Thorne and Andrew McKeever.
